#2
Shortly after Apple discontinued them I sold mine for about 3x what I paid for it. These days, though, I dunno -- only FW400 connectivity, seems that it's days have past. Best bet is to do a "Sold Items" search on ebay and see what's what -- but think of it this way, anything you sell it for is more than you currently have for it, esp if it's just sitting in a drawer somewhere.
